🔎 Washtenaw County Probate Court Case Search (Official Workflow)
Michigan probate cases can be searched through the official MiCOURT public portal.
- Go to → MiCOURT Case Search
- Select search method:
- Name search
- Case number search
- Court search
- Enter Washtenaw County details
- Review matching cases
- Open docket summary and activity
What You Can View Online
- Case number and filing date
- Party names
- Case type (estate, guardianship, conservatorship)
- Docket entries
- Hearing activity
Common Search Issues & Fixes
- No results → try alternate spellings
- New case not visible → allow 1–2 business days
- Older file unavailable → request archive lookup
📂 How to Get Washtenaw County Probate Court Records (Full Documents)
Most official probate files and certified documents are handled through the court clerk.
- Search case first and note case number
- Request records:
- In person
- Mail request
- Email / phone guidance
- Provide:
- Case number
- Name of decedent or protected person
- Specific documents needed
- Pay copy or certification fees if required
Available Records
- Estate files
- Wills admitted to probate
- Letters of Authority
- Guardianship records
- Conservatorship files
- Court orders and judgments
Records NOT Public
- Adoption files
- Mental health matters
- Sealed proceedings
- Certain confidential guardianship records

⚖️ What Washtenaw County Probate Court Handles
The Probate Court handles matters involving estates and legally protected individuals under Michigan law.
- Wills and decedent estates
- Guardianships
- Conservatorships
- Trust administration
- Mental health proceedings
- Protective orders in probate matters
The court ensures lawful estate administration and protection of minors and incapacitated adults.
